Interior of Breuer's CMA Education Wing ID: 11198 | This file appears in: Cleveland Trust Tower Marcel Breuer received his commission to add a wing to the Cleveland Museum of Art shortly before his Cleveland Trust commission. The Breuer addition, completed in 1971, was artfully incorporated into the CMA's massive expansion that used a soaring glass atrium and flanking gallery buildings to connect Breuer's building with Hubbell & Benes's original marble 1916 building. | Creator: Tim Evanson | Date: February 10, 2017 | Source: Flickr, CC BY-SA 2.0 Download Original File CreatorTim EvansonSourceFlickr, CC BY-SA 2.0DateFebruary 10, 2017 "Interior of Breuer's CMA Education Wing" appears in: Cleveland Trust Tower
